One key metric that jumps out to me to add is proximity to the hole. If someone has a high GIR they will have a higher Avg. Putts Per Round correlation over time. They can hit 100% of GIR but if the first putt is 70+ft each time, 3 putt frequency will be high. But instead of practicing lag putting, in that scenario a person will gain more be working on their approach shots. Strokes Gained Approach is really the key statistic you should be improving to shoot lower scores.
Hitting it closer is usually set up by hitting it further, not necessarily hitting fairways (see DECADE Golf and/or Bryson).
